Which of the online sites listed below is the most credible source of information during a breaking news story?


tmz.com, a celebrity and entertainment news website


Twitter


Facebook


npr.org, the website of National Public Radio

npr.org — National Public Radio is the most credible of those options. NPR is a professional news organization with editorial standards, trained reporters, attribution and correction practices, and a focus on verification.

Twitter and Facebook can be fast sources of tips and eyewitness content but are unverified and prone to rumors; TMZ is focused on celebrity/entertainment and is not a general breaking-news authority. In any breaking story, cross-check multiple reputable outlets and official sources (police, emergency agencies) before trusting or sharing information.
